The Otilimab ELISA Kit is composed of several components, including a microplate coated with a capture antibody, a detection antibody, and a colorimetric substrate. The capture antibody is specific for otilimab and is immobilized onto the surface of the microplate. The detection antibody is labeled with an enzyme, such as horseradish peroxidase, and is specific for a different epitope on otilimab. The colorimetric substrate is added after the sample and detection antibody have been incubated on the plate, and the resulting color change is measured to determine the amount of otilimab present in the sample.
The Otilimab ELISA Kit works on the principle of sandwich immunoassay. This means that the capture antibody and detection antibody bind to different epitopes on otilimab, resulting in the formation of a sandwich complex. The colorimetric substrate is then added, and the enzyme on the detection antibody catalyzes a reaction that produces a color change. The intensity of the color is directly proportional to the amount of otilimab present in the sample, allowing for accurate quantification.
